Anti-Phospholipid Antibody (IgG) ( IO0031 )

Description

Anti-Phospholipid IgG Antibodies test detects IgG autoantibodies directed against phospholipid-binding proteins and is essential in evaluating antiphospholipid syndrome (APS). These antibodies are associated with abnormal blood clotting, recurrent miscarriages, stillbirths, thrombosis, and certain autoimmune conditions such as lupus.

Measured commonly by ELISA, this test supports the diagnosis of APS when interpreted with clinical history and other markers (e.g., lupus anticoagulant, anti-cardiolipin). It is particularly valuable in patients with unexplained venous/arterial thrombosis, pregnancy losses, prolonged APTT, or suspected autoimmune disease. Serial testing (≥12 weeks apart) may be required for confirmation as per guidelines.
